Daniel solves the equation 3(x+1)-5=3x-2 and states that it has no solution. Is he correct?
Explain why and why not.

He is incorrect

Step-by-step explanation:

Given

3(x + 1) - 5 = 3x - 2 ← simplify left side

3x + 3 - 5 = 3x - 2

3x - 2 = 3x - 2

Since both sides are equal, then this indicates that the equation has infinite solutions.
